Rare earth magnets, the strongest type of permanent magnets, are critical components in modern technology. Composed primarily of neodymium (NdFeB) and samarium-cobalt (SmCo) alloys, they are indispensable in industries such as renewable energy, electric vehicles (EVs), consumer electronics, medical devices, and aerospace. Their exceptional magnetic strength and durability make them irreplaceable in high-performance applications.

Neodymium Magnets Process
- Raw Material Mixing: Neodymium, iron, and boron are mixed with minor elements to optimize properties.
- Melting and Casting: The mixture is melted, cast into molds, and cooled into alloy blocks.
- Powdering: The blocks are crushed into fine powder.
- Pressing and Aligning: The powder is pressed in a magnetic field to align the particles.
- Sintering: The pressed powder is heated to fuse particles, forming solid magnets.
- Shaping: Magnets are cut and shaped as needed.
- Coating: A protective layer, like nickel or epoxy, is applied to prevent corrosion.
- Magnetization: Magnets are exposed to a strong magnetic field to activate their magnetic properties.
- Quality Control: Each magnet is tested for strength, precision, and coating quality.
